The Economic Freedom Fighters (EFF) and ActionSA have rejected the reconfiguration of the City of Ekurhuleni’s mayoral committee, in what appears to be a brewing political storm.
Residents woke up to a reshuffled mayoral committee today, after Executive Mayor Nkosiphindile Xhakaza, announced changes to his administration.
Xhakaza made several changes, including replacing the EFF’s Bridgette Thusi with ActionSA councillor Xolani Khumalo in the Community Services portfolio.
He also removed the EFF’s Bridgette Thusi as MMC for Human Settlements.

The EFF has declined the offer to serve on the reconfigured committee, saying it is comfortable remaining in the opposition benches.
“It is crystal clear that these changes are not made in the best interests of the people of Ekurhuleni, but rather to satisfy selfish political interests and to boost fragile egos within the ANC,” the part said in a statement. “The ANC and Mayor Xhakaza are hellbent on demonstrating that selfish political maneuvering and internal factional battles are more important to them than the interests of the people of Ekurhuleni.
“This pattern is not new. It has been consistent since the removal of Commissar Nkululeko Dunga as MMC for Finance in 2024, immediately after he had turned that department around and stabilised its operations,” the party added.
Meanwhile, Action SA also rejected any suggestion that it would join what they’ve described as a failing government.
“This statement is entirely fabricated and does not reflect any engagement or agreement involving ActionSA,” the party said.
ActionSA maintains it has previously rebuffed what it describes as attempts by Xhakaza to draw the party into his administration.
“Our position has been very clear on every occasion that we will not lend credibility to an administration that has overseen the lawlessness and deterioration of service delivery that continues to cripple the city,” the party said. The people of Ekurhuleni are tired of dysfunction, lawlessness and the collapse of basic municipal services.”
“ActionSA’s focus remains on restoring governance, cleaning out corruption, restoring the rule of law and fixing the fundamentals of service delivery.”
